Description

FIG. 1 is a perspective view of an occupational therapy garment showing our new design applied in an exemplary environment;

FIG. 2 is an outside view shown open and spread flat thereof; and,

FIG. 3 is an inside view shown open and spread flat view thereof.

The broken lines shown in FIG. 1 are for environmental purposes only and form no part of the claimed design. The clasp elements depicted by broken lines in the drawing figures have been shown for the purpose of illustrating portions of the occupational therapy garment that form no part of the claimed design.

Claims

The ornamental design for an occupational therapy garment, as shown and described.
